The Keweenaw Peninsula has so many amazing experiences to add to your Michigan road trip that we had a hard time picking only 5! Here are some of our favorite experiences while exploring the Keweenaw Peninsula 🚗
📍Quincy Mine- Located in Hancock, MI ⚒️Tour one of the earliest mines in Michigan’s Copper Country and get a glimpse of the mining industry and lifestyle.
📍 Eagle Harbor Lighthouse in Eagle Harbor MI
⚓️ Take in the amazing view of Lake Superior and the beautiful Eagle Harbor Lighthouse. This historical lighthouse is still in operation today and is one of Michigan’s most photographed lighthouses.
📍Keweenaw Historical National Park in Calumet, MI
🔎 Step back in time and learn about the unique history of Michigan’s Copper Country and cultural heritage as you walk along the historical district of downtown Calumet. The Keweenaw Historical National Park also has sites to explore in the surrounding area so stop in the visitor center to get your map!
📍 Estivant Pines in Copper Harbor, MI
🌲Take a hike the one of Michigan’s last White Pine Old-Growth forests. These White Pines grow over 125 feet, 3-5 feet wide and date back 300-500 years!
📍 The Jampot in Eagle Harbor, MI
🥮 The Jampot is a favorite for boozy fruitcakes, decadent baked treats and fruitful jams like their famous Thimbleberry Jam. This small but delicious bakery helps support the local monks from the Byzantine Catholic Monastery in neighboring Mohawk, MI.
📍Jacob Falls in Eagle Harbor, MI
